Exercise 2: AdaBoost as an Optimization Problem (25 + 25 P) Consider AdaBoost for binary classification applied to some dataset D = {(x1, y1), . . . , (xN , yN )}. The algorithm starts with uniform weighting (∀N i=1 : p(1) = 1/N) and performs the following iteration: i for t = 1 . . . T : Step 1: Step 2: Step 3: Step 4: D, p(t) 􏰕→ ht εt = Ep(t) [1(ht(x)̸=y)] αt = 1 log 􏰁 1 − εt 􏰂 2 εt ∀N : p(t+1) = Z−1p(t) exp(−α y h (x )) i=1i ti titi (learn tth weak classifier using weighting p(t)) (compute the weighted error of the classifier) (set its contribution to the boosted classifier) (set a new weighting for the data) t 􏰈 p(t) t 􏰈 p(t) i:yi =+1 i i:yi =−1 i The term Ep(t) [·] denotes the expectation under the data weighting p(t), and Zt is a normalization term. An interesting property of AdaBoost is that it can be shown to minimize some objective function G(α) = 􏰀 exp(−yifα,t(xi)) where fα,t(x) = 􏰈tτ=1 ατhτ(x) is the output score of the boosted classifier after t iterations.
